BigQuery/Redshift/ClickHouse: How to choose the best database management system for AdTech projects

AdTech products’ success rates are predicated on the efficient collection and use of big data — but more importantly, on how it is stored, processed, and analyzed.

Advertising platforms must deliver multi-dimensional insights on real-time and historical campaign performance. To follow the industry trends in omnichannel ad attribution and cross-platform customer profiles, there’s a lot of data that AdTech companies need to store, move, and process every minute.

Consequently, adopting a flexible database management solution (DBMS) is a must.

In this post, we discuss:

  • What a database management system is and its role in data warehousing

  • Common types of DBMS with an in-depth OLTP vs. OLAP comparison

  • Redshift AWS, Google BigQuerry, and ClickHouse as top DBMS options for AdTech

What is a database management system (DBMS)?

A database management system (DBMS) is a software package designed to facilitate data retrieval, manipulation, and management in a centralized database.

A DBMS provides a “template” for organizing all the aggregated data by type, format, or another parameter. It also serves as an interface between the data storage tier (e.g., distributed data store) and the software application consuming the data (e.g., your DSP or SSP).

A DBMS is one of the central data warehousing concepts.

Xenoss - an Ad Tech/Mar Tech software development house has created this article to give you insights on the topic.

Discover more HERE.